The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of James Hill, born in 1830 in Newton-Le-Willows, Lancashire, consisted of 4 members. James was the head of the household, married to Elizabeth Hill, born in 1834 in Pemberton, Lancashire, England. They had 1 child; John, born 1862 in Pemberton, Lancashire, England.
During the period, also present in the household was James's Lodger, John Brown, born in 1859 in Leicester, Leicestershire, England.
